手機(jī)軟件作為移動(dòng)互聯(lián)網(wǎng)的重要組成部分,在開(kāi)發(fā)時(shí)需要進(jìn)行調(diào)試來(lái)保證軟件的穩(wěn)定性和用戶體驗(yàn)。調(diào)試手機(jī)軟件并不容易,下面將介紹幾個(gè)技巧,幫助您輕松完成調(diào)試。
1.使用調(diào)試工具
使用調(diào)試工具可以有效地找出程序中的錯(cuò)誤,一些常用的調(diào)試工具包括:AndroidStudio、Xcode、Eclipse等等。這些軟件可以提供嚴(yán)密的調(diào)試能力,包括代碼調(diào)試、內(nèi)存調(diào)試等等。
2.設(shè)置斷點(diǎn)
設(shè)置斷點(diǎn)可以幫助開(kāi)發(fā)者快速定位問(wèn)題,當(dāng)代碼執(zhí)行到斷點(diǎn)處就會(huì)暫停,可以用這個(gè)機(jī)會(huì)查看各個(gè)變量的值,分析問(wèn)題的原因。調(diào)試工具中一般都支持設(shè)置斷點(diǎn)。
3.打印日志
打印日志也是一種常見(jiàn)的調(diào)試方法,通過(guò)在代碼中添加輸出語(yǔ)句可以查看程序中的一些狀態(tài)和變量的值。但是也要注意控制打印語(yǔ)句的數(shù)量,避免日志輸出過(guò)多而影響程序性能。
4.模擬器調(diào)試
使用模擬器可以避免調(diào)試時(shí)需要不斷連接和斷開(kāi)手機(jī)的繁瑣操作。模擬器可以模擬不同的操作系統(tǒng)和硬件設(shè)備,提供更多的測(cè)試場(chǎng)景,讓開(kāi)發(fā)者可以更全面地測(cè)試自己的應(yīng)用。
5.使用真機(jī)調(diào)試
盡管使用模擬器可以節(jié)省更多的時(shí)間和精力,但是在一些特定的場(chǎng)景下需要使用真機(jī)調(diào)試。真機(jī)調(diào)試可以更好地檢驗(yàn)應(yīng)用在實(shí)際手機(jī)上的運(yùn)行情況,準(zhǔn)確地發(fā)現(xiàn)和解決各種問(wèn)題。
6.團(tuán)隊(duì)協(xié)作
在調(diào)試過(guò)程中,和團(tuán)隊(duì)成員的合作也非常重要。合理分工、互相合作、及時(shí)分享調(diào)試結(jié)果,可以大大提高調(diào)試效率和成功率。
總之,調(diào)試手機(jī)軟件需要掌握相應(yīng)的技術(shù)方法,同時(shí)也需要付出更多的耐心和精力。相信掌握了以上幾個(gè)技巧,您可以更加輕松、高效地完成應(yīng)用程序的調(diào)試。